17,218,738,163,484 is an even composite number composed of seven prime numbers multiplied together.

What does the number 17218738163484 look like?

This visualization shows the relationship between its 7 prime factors (large circles) and 864 divisors.

17218738163484 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of eight hundred sixty-four divisors.

Prime factorization of 17218738163484:

22 × 35 × 11 × 132 × 31 × 97 × 3169

(2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 11 × 13 × 13 × 31 × 97 × 3169)
